Moon Sign Meanings

In astrology, your Moon sign describes your inner emotional world, the instincts and needs that show up when you're not performing for anyone. Below is a breakdown of what each of the 12 Moon signs is traditionally associated with. Moon in Aries

Element: Fire · Reacts first, reflects later

A Moon in Aries responds to feelings fast and directly, there's little patience for sitting with unresolved emotion. Frustration surfaces quickly and passes quickly too. Emotional security comes from having room to act on instinct rather than waiting for permission, and this placement often shows up as a short temper paired with an equally short memory for grudges.

Moon in Taurus

Element: Earth · Steady, values comfort and routine

A Moon in Taurus finds emotional security in stability: familiar routines, physical comfort, and reliable people. Change is processed slowly and feelings run deep but are rarely dramatic on the surface. Being rushed emotionally tends to backfire; this placement generally needs time, good food, and a comfortable environment to truly settle.

Moon in Gemini

Element: Air · Processes feelings by talking them through

A Moon in Gemini makes sense of emotion through words, talking, writing, or turning a feeling over from multiple angles until it resolves. Moods can shift quickly, and mental stimulation is as emotionally satisfying as comfort itself. A good conversation can do more for this placement's mood than almost anything else.

Moon in Cancer

Element: Water · Deeply intuitive and protective

The Moon rules Cancer, so this placement is considered especially strong. Emotions run close to the surface, intuition is sharp, and there's a natural instinct to nurture and protect the people closest to them. Home and family tend to matter enormously, and this Moon sign is often the most quietly sentimental of the twelve.

Moon in Leo

Element: Fire · Warm, wants to feel seen

A Moon in Leo feels most secure when appreciated and warmly acknowledged. Generosity comes naturally, and emotional expression tends to be big rather than hidden, being ignored stings more than almost anything else. This placement often expresses love through grand, generous gestures rather than quiet ones.

Moon in Virgo

Element: Earth · Copes through order and usefulness

A Moon in Virgo processes stress by organizing, fixing, and being genuinely useful to others. Feelings are often filtered through practical action rather than expressed outright, helping IS the emotional language here. A tidy, well-run environment can calm this placement faster than a conversation about feelings ever could.

Moon in Libra

Element: Air · Seeks harmony, avoids conflict

A Moon in Libra finds emotional security in balanced, fair relationships. Conflict feels genuinely uncomfortable, and there's a strong instinct to smooth things over and see every side of a disagreement before settling on how they feel. Partnership itself, having someone to process life with, tends to matter a great deal.

Moon in Scorpio

Element: Water · Intense, feels everything privately

A Moon in Scorpio experiences emotion at full intensity, but rarely on display. Trust is earned slowly and guarded fiercely once given. There's a natural instinct to notice what's beneath the surface, in themselves and everyone else, which can make this one of the more perceptive placements in a birth chart.

Moon in Sagittarius

Element: Fire · Needs freedom and movement

A Moon in Sagittarius processes feelings best on the move, literally or through new ideas and experiences. Emotional security comes from having room to explore; feeling boxed in is one of the fastest ways to trigger restlessness. Humor and optimism are common coping tools for this placement.

Moon in Capricorn

Element: Earth · Reserved, shows care through responsibility

A Moon in Capricorn tends to keep emotions contained and composed, showing care through reliability and follow-through rather than open displays. Vulnerability is real but rarely worn on the sleeve, trust builds through consistency over time rather than grand declarations.

Moon in Aquarius

Element: Air · Processes feelings intellectually

A Moon in Aquarius tends to think through emotions before feeling fully immersed in them, valuing independence and a bit of emotional distance even from people they're close to. Friendship and shared ideals matter as much as romance, and this placement often prefers a slightly unconventional emotional style.

Moon in Pisces

Element: Water · Highly empathetic, absorbs others' moods

A Moon in Pisces is especially sensitive to the emotional atmosphere around them, often picking up on others' feelings before their own. Imagination and compassion run deep, and clear emotional boundaries can take real, conscious effort. Frequently Asked Questions

What does your Moon sign personality mean?
Your Moon sign personality refers to the emotional, instinctive side of you: how you process feelings, what makes you feel secure, and how you react under stress, as distinct from your Sun sign's more outward-facing identity.

Can my Moon sign be the same as my Sun sign?
Yes, it's possible, though not guaranteed, for your Sun and Moon sign to match. Since the Moon moves through all 12 signs roughly every month while the Sun takes a year, most people have a different Moon sign than their Sun sign.
Which Moon sign is considered the most emotional?
Water Moon signs, Cancer, Scorpio, and Pisces, are traditionally described as the most emotionally sensitive and intuitive, since water is astrology's element of feeling. Cancer is considered especially strong here because the Moon rules Cancer.
